Web17. júl 2015 · Eating large amounts of soy can inhibit the activity of thyroid peroxidase (TPO) and cause the thyroid to be inflamed. If you have a thyroid disorder, you may want to limit your intake of soy. Examples of soy foods include tofu, soy milk, and foods that are meat-alternatives. Be sure to read labels for hidden sources of soy.

In rare cases, some of the chemicals found in soy products like soy milk or edamame could hurt your thyroid’s ability to make hormones, but only if you don't get enough iodine and ... Web11. apr 2024 · Soy contains compounds that may interfere with thyroid function and cause your thyroid to grow. Limiting or avoiding foods high in soy is a good idea if you have hyperthyroidism. These foods include: edamame; meat alternatives ; soy milk; soy nuts; soy sauce; tofu; soybeans
